Solution:
1. Start with the percentage value: 69\%.
2. Convert the percentage to a decimal by dividing by 100:
* 69\% = \frac{69}{100}.
3. Perform the division:
* \frac{69}{100} = 0.69.
Therefore, the decimal representation of 69% is 0.69.
